Resumo: A real situation, such as the cleaning of the Paranoá lake shoreline in Brasilia, Brazil, conceived a teaching-learning environment, supported by the project-based learning method (PjBL), in order to introduce solution proposals in the scope of the Sustainable Development Goals (SDGs) in the background of engineering students. A team of Mechanical, Mechatronics, and Production Engineering students was constituted to study the problem and develop a floating waste collection system. The study involved applied research and resulted in the control design of a machine for collecting materials on water surfaces. A prototype was built and tested to validate the control design.
